Skip to content

Commit cdb26e3

Browse files
committed
chore: format parser package
1 parent 2706de5 commit cdb26e3

File tree

27 files changed

+142
-163
lines changed

27 files changed

+142
-163
lines changed

packages/parser/src/envelopes/index.ts

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,11 +4,11 @@ export { CloudWatchEnvelope } from './cloudwatch.js';
44
export { DynamoDBStreamEnvelope } from './dynamodb.js';
55
export { EventBridgeEnvelope } from './eventbridge.js';
66
export { KafkaEnvelope } from './kafka.js';
7-
export { KinesisFirehoseEnvelope } from './kinesis-firehose.js';
87
export { KinesisEnvelope } from './kinesis.js';
8+
export { KinesisFirehoseEnvelope } from './kinesis-firehose.js';
99
export { LambdaFunctionUrlEnvelope } from './lambda.js';
10-
export { SnsSqsEnvelope } from './sns-sqs.js';
1110
export { SnsEnvelope } from './sns.js';
11+
export { SnsSqsEnvelope } from './sns-sqs.js';
1212
export { SqsEnvelope } from './sqs.js';
1313
export { VpcLatticeEnvelope } from './vpc-lattice.js';
1414
export { VpcLatticeV2Envelope } from './vpc-latticev2.js';

packages/parser/src/helpers/dynamodb.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-70,7 +70,7 @@ const DynamoDBMarshalled = <T extends ZodTypeAny>(schema: T) =>
7070
.transform((str, ctx) => {
7171
try {
7272
return unmarshallDynamoDB(str);
73-
} catch (err) {
73+
} catch {
7474
ctx.addIssue({
7575
code: 'custom',
7676
message: 'Could not unmarshall DynamoDB stream record',

packages/parser/src/helpers/index.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-44,7 +44,7 @@ const JSONStringified = <T extends ZodTypeAny>(schema: T) =>
4444
.transform((str, ctx) => {
4545
try {
4646
return JSON.parse(str);
47-
} catch (err) {
47+
} catch {
4848
ctx.addIssue({
4949
code: 'custom',
5050
message: 'Invalid JSON',

packages/parser/src/index.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,2 +1,2 @@
1-
export { parser } from './parserDecorator.js';
21
export { ParseError } from './errors.js';
2+
export { parser } from './parserDecorator.js';

packages/parser/src/schemas/api-gateway-websocket.ts

Lines changed: 7 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-67,14 +67,17 @@ export const APIGatewayProxyWebsocketEventSchema = z.object({
6767
headers: z.record(z.string()),
6868
multiValueHeaders: z.record(z.array(z.string())),
6969
queryStringParameters: z.record(z.string()).nullable().optional(),
70-
multiValueQueryStringParameters: z.record(z.array(z.string())).nullable().optional(),
70+
multiValueQueryStringParameters: z
71+
.record(z.array(z.string()))
72+
.nullable()
73+
.optional(),
7174
stageVariables: z.record(z.string()).nullable().optional(),
7275
requestContext: z.object({
7376
routeKey: z.string(),
74-
eventType: z.enum(["CONNECT", "DISCONNECT", "MESSAGE"]),
77+
eventType: z.enum(['CONNECT', 'DISCONNECT', 'MESSAGE']),
7578
extendedRequestId: z.string(),
7679
requestTime: z.string(),
77-
messageDirection: z.enum(["IN", "OUT"]),
80+
messageDirection: z.enum(['IN', 'OUT']),
7881
stage: z.string(),
7982
connectedAt: z.number(),
8083
requestTimeEpoch: z.number(),
@@ -89,4 +92,4 @@ export const APIGatewayProxyWebsocketEventSchema = z.object({
8992
}),
9093
isBase64Encoded: z.boolean(),
9194
body: z.string().optional().nullable(),
92-
});
95+
});

packages/parser/src/schemas/cloudwatch.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@ const decompressRecordToJSON = (
2626
);
2727

2828
return CloudWatchLogsDecodeSchema.parse(JSON.parse(uncompressed));
29-
} catch (error) {
29+
} catch {
3030
throw new DecompressError('Failed to decompress CloudWatch log data');
3131
}
3232
};

packages/parser/src/schemas/dynamodb.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-40,7 +40,7 @@ const unmarshallDynamoDBTransform = (
4040
try {
4141
// @ts-expect-error
4242
return unmarshallDynamoDB(image) as Record<string, unknown>;
43-
} catch (err) {
43+
} catch {
4444
ctx.addIssue({
4545
code: 'custom',
4646
message: `Could not unmarshall ${imageName} in DynamoDB stream record`,

packages/parser/src/schemas/index.ts

Lines changed: 30 additions & 30 deletions
Original file line numberDiff line numberDiff line change
@@ -1,28 +1,28 @@
1-
export { AlbSchema, AlbMultiValueHeadersSchema } from './alb.js';
1+
export { AlbMultiValueHeadersSchema, AlbSchema } from './alb.js';
22
export {
3+
APIGatewayEventRequestContextSchema,
34
APIGatewayProxyEventSchema,
45
APIGatewayRequestAuthorizerEventSchema,
56
APIGatewayTokenAuthorizerEventSchema,
6-
APIGatewayEventRequestContextSchema,
77
} from './api-gateway.js';
88
export { APIGatewayProxyWebsocketEventSchema } from './api-gateway-websocket.js';
99
export {
10-
AppSyncResolverSchema,
10+
APIGatewayProxyEventV2Schema,
11+
APIGatewayRequestAuthorizerEventV2Schema,
12+
APIGatewayRequestAuthorizerV2Schema,
13+
APIGatewayRequestContextV2Schema,
14+
} from './api-gatewayv2.js';
15+
export {
1116
AppSyncBatchResolverSchema,
17+
AppSyncResolverSchema,
1218
} from './appsync.js';
1319
export {
1420
AppSyncEventsBaseSchema,
15-
AppSyncEventsRequestSchema,
1621
AppSyncEventsInfoSchema,
1722
AppSyncEventsPublishSchema,
23+
AppSyncEventsRequestSchema,
1824
AppSyncEventsSubscribeSchema,
1925
} from './appsync-events.js';
20-
export {
21-
APIGatewayProxyEventV2Schema,
22-
APIGatewayRequestAuthorizerEventV2Schema,
23-
APIGatewayRequestAuthorizerV2Schema,
24-
APIGatewayRequestContextV2Schema,
25-
} from './api-gatewayv2.js';
2626
export {
2727
CloudFormationCustomResourceCreateSchema,
2828
CloudFormationCustomResourceDeleteSchema,
@@ -34,18 +34,18 @@ export {
3434
CloudWatchLogsSchema,
3535
} from './cloudwatch.js';
3636
export {
37-
PreSignupTriggerSchema,
37+
CreateAuthChallengeTriggerSchema,
38+
CustomEmailSenderTriggerSchema,
39+
CustomMessageTriggerSchema,
40+
CustomSMSSenderTriggerSchema,
41+
DefineAuthChallengeTriggerSchema,
42+
MigrateUserTriggerSchema,
43+
PostAuthenticationTriggerSchema,
3844
PostConfirmationTriggerSchema,
3945
PreAuthenticationTriggerSchema,
40-
PostAuthenticationTriggerSchema,
46+
PreSignupTriggerSchema,
4147
PreTokenGenerationTriggerSchemaV1,
4248
PreTokenGenerationTriggerSchemaV2AndV3,
43-
MigrateUserTriggerSchema,
44-
CustomMessageTriggerSchema,
45-
CustomEmailSenderTriggerSchema,
46-
CustomSMSSenderTriggerSchema,
47-
DefineAuthChallengeTriggerSchema,
48-
CreateAuthChallengeTriggerSchema,
4949
VerifyAuthChallengeTriggerSchema,
5050
} from './cognito.js';
5151
export {
@@ -55,40 +55,40 @@ export {
5555
export { EventBridgeSchema } from './eventbridge.js';
5656
export {
5757
KafkaMskEventSchema,
58-
KafkaSelfManagedEventSchema,
5958
KafkaRecordSchema,
59+
KafkaSelfManagedEventSchema,
6060
} from './kafka.js';
6161
export {
62+
KinesisDataStreamRecord,
6263
KinesisDataStreamSchema,
6364
KinesisDynamoDBStreamSchema,
64-
KinesisDataStreamRecord,
6565
} from './kinesis.js';
6666
export {
67-
KinesisFirehoseSchema,
68-
KinesisFirehoseSqsSchema,
6967
KinesisFirehoseRecordSchema,
68+
KinesisFirehoseSchema,
7069
KinesisFirehoseSqsRecordSchema,
70+
KinesisFirehoseSqsSchema,
7171
} from './kinesis-firehose.js';
7272
export { LambdaFunctionUrlSchema } from './lambda.js';
7373
export {
74-
S3SqsEventNotificationSchema,
7574
S3EventNotificationEventBridgeSchema,
7675
S3ObjectLambdaEventSchema,
7776
S3Schema,
77+
S3SqsEventNotificationSchema,
7878
} from './s3.js';
79-
export { SesSchema, SesRecordSchema } from './ses.js';
79+
export { SesRecordSchema, SesSchema } from './ses.js';
8080
export {
81-
SnsSchema,
81+
SnsNotificationSchema,
8282
SnsRecordSchema,
83+
SnsSchema,
8384
SnsSqsNotificationSchema,
84-
SnsNotificationSchema,
8585
} from './sns.js';
8686
export {
87-
SqsSchema,
88-
SqsRecordSchema,
89-
SqsMsgAttributeSchema,
90-
SqsMsgAttributeDataTypeSchema,
9187
SqsAttributesSchema,
88+
SqsMsgAttributeDataTypeSchema,
89+
SqsMsgAttributeSchema,
90+
SqsRecordSchema,
91+
SqsSchema,
9292
} from './sqs.js';
9393
export { TransferFamilySchema } from './transfer-family.js';
9494
export { VpcLatticeSchema } from './vpc-lattice.js';

packages/parser/src/schemas/kinesis-firehose.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-40,7 +40,7 @@ const KinesisFirehoseSqsRecordSchema = KinesisFireHoseRecordBase.extend({
4040
return SqsRecordSchema.parse(
4141
JSON.parse(Buffer.from(data, 'base64').toString('utf8'))
4242
);
43-
} catch (e) {
43+
} catch {
4444
ctx.addIssue({
4545
code: z.ZodIssueCode.custom,
4646
message: 'Failed to parse SQS record',

packages/parser/src/schemas/kinesis.ts

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-16,7 +16,7 @@ const KinesisDataStreamRecordPayload = z.object({
1616
try {
1717
// If data was not compressed, try to parse it as JSON otherwise it must be string
1818
return decompressed === data ? JSON.parse(decoded) : decompressed;
19-
} catch (e) {
19+
} catch {
2020
return decoded;
2121
}
2222
}),
@@ -25,7 +25,7 @@ const KinesisDataStreamRecordPayload = z.object({
2525
const decompress = (data: string): string => {
2626
try {
2727
return JSON.parse(gunzipSync(fromBase64(data, 'base64')).toString('utf8'));
28-
} catch (e) {
28+
} catch {
2929
return data;
3030
}
3131
};

0 commit comments

Comments
 (0)